How to use Uber at the Las Vegas Airport

Instead of standing around looking like a tourist, like I did for about 10 minutes, follow these simple instructions to make grabbing an Uber from Las Vegas’ airport Terminal 1 a breeze!

I flew into Las Vegas on Southwest from Orange County. If you fly Southwest, or one of these other airlines, you’ll find yourself at Terminal 1 Baggage Claim after you get off your plane:

  • Allegiant
  • American
  • Delta
  • Omni
  • Southwest
  • Spirit Airlines

Step 1 – Get off the plane and head to Terminal 1 Baggage Claim

When you get to Baggage Claim, don’t go outside! The only thing waiting for you is heat, taxis, and rental car shuttles. If you don’t have checked luggage, go ahead and request your Uber ride as you’re walking off the plane. Your ride should be here about the same time you get to the pick-up spot.

If you have to wait for Baggage Claim, then request your Uber as soon as you have recovered all of your bags.

Step 2 – Go towards the ParkingGarage

When Uber was (finally!) allowed to pick up passengers at McCarran, there were certain accommodations made to keep the peace with taxi drivers and shuttles. So, rather than picking up passengers curbside, like a normal person, everyone is inconvenienced by having to go to the parking garage.

Step 3 – Take elevator to the 2nd floor

Once you get to the elevator, take it to the 2nd floor.

Step 4 – Once you get off the elevator, cross the pedestrian bridge

The pedestrian bridge allows you to cross over all of the traffic below.

Step 5 – Take the elevator the “2M” Level

You want to take the elevator to the Mezzanine level of the parking garage.

Step 6 – Get off the elevator and turn right to the pick-up spot

When you get off the elevator, you’ll see a sign directing you to turn right.

Conclusion

All of these pictures may make it seem like it takes forever to get to your Uber ride at Las Vegas’ McCarran Airport. It really doesn’t. Walking at a normal pace, you will get to your ride in about 5-10 minutes. I waited outside of Baggage Claim for longer than that before I realized I was in the wrong spot.
